WebFeb 14, 2019 · Instructions. In a large bowl, whisk flour, baking soda, baking powder and salt until well combined. In a separate large bowl …

1. In a large bowl, whisk flour, baking soda, baking powder and salt until well combined.
2. In a separate large bowl (using an electric hand mixer) or in the bowl of a stand mixer with paddle attachment, cream butter and 1 1/2 cups sugar on medium speed 3-4 minutes until light and fluffy. Beat in egg and vanilla.
3. Slowly stir in dry ingredients just until a dough forms. Cover bowl with plastic wrap and refrigerate dough 1 hour.
4. Heat oven to 350F. Line a cookie sheet with parchment paper. Add remaining 1/2 cup sugar to a small bowl. Scoop and roll chilled dough into balls about 1 to 1 1/2 inches in diameter (about 1-2 tablespoons each). Roll each dough ball in sugar, then transfer to cookie sheet, spacing cookies about 2 inches apart (the dough balls might not all fit on one sheet; refrigerate whatever doesn’t fit until you’re ready to bake the second batch).

WebDec 3, 2020 · Instructions. In a mixing bowl, cream together the shortening and sugar. Add eggs, milk, and vanilla and mix. In a separate bowl, mix …

1. In a mixing bowl, cream together the shortening and sugar.
2. Add eggs, milk, and vanilla and mix.
3. In a separate bowl, mix dry ingredients--(flour, baking powder, and salt. Slowly mix dry ingredients into the wet mixture until you form a large dough ball. Refrigerate for 20-30 minutes.
4. Lightly flour your counter top. Roll dough ball out until 1/2 inch to 3/4 inch thick. Cut the dough into shapes with cookie cutters (or use a round drinking cup)
